What the Premium Residential Lift Service Includes

Procuring a residential elevator requires an all-inclusive technical delivery framework that covers engineering design, component sourcing, logistics, precision alignment, and final regulatory sign-off. Property developers must recognise that the base hardware component comprises only a portion of the total financial deployment. A detailed breakdown ensures full operational transparency between engineering teams and property owners.

We utilize a comprehensive delivery scope to eliminate hidden capital expenditures during physical site handover:

Line Item ElementInclusion StatusTechnical Engineering Notes
Mechanical Component SourcingFully IncludedCore gearless traction machines, suspension traction media, car frames, and safety blocks.
Electrical Control SystemsFully IncludedMicroprocessor panels, variable voltage variable frequency drives, and landing operating panels.
Shaft Civil ConstructionExplicitly ExcludedProperty developers must construct the brick or concrete shaft shell based on official structural layouts.
Slab Core Cutting & AlterationExplicitly ExcludedStructural modifications to concrete slabs remain under the owner’s civil engineering contractor.
Precision Rail AlignmentFully IncludedLaser-guided positioning of T-guide rails along the absolute vertical axis of the elevator shaft.
Automatic Rescue Device (ARD)Fully IncludedIntegrated battery power storage unit that brings the lift cabin to the nearest floor level during grid drops.
Regulatory Liaison SupportFully IncludedPreparing structural drawings and technical documentation for state electrical inspectorate filing.
Initial Safety InspectionFully IncludedComprehensive statutory load-testing, speed validation, and mechanical stress verification checks.

Pricing Factors and Cost Ranges

What is the average Schindler home lift price in India?

The market price for a standard Schindler home lift or premium residential elevator in India typically ranges from INR 12,00,000 to INR 28,00,000 for basic low-rise residential structures. This pricing depends on the number of travel stops, interior cabin customization options, architectural shaft variations, and specific equipment models.

[Low-Rise Basic Configuration] ₹12,00,000 – ₹16,00,000
[Mid-Range / Multi-Floor Premium] ₹16,00,000 – ₹22,00,000
[Ultra-Luxury Custom Glass / Bespoke] ₹22,00,000 – ₹28,00,000+

Our field analysis identifies four distinct engineering variables that dictate where a project falls along this financial continuum:

  • Building Height and Travel Stops: Each additional floor level demands extra structural guide rails, traveling cables, wire harnesses, and mechanical landing door assemblies, scaling the overall cost framework.
  • Elevator Drive Technology: Machine-Room-Less (MRL) gearless traction systems utilize permanent magnet synchronous motors. These premium systems demand higher initial capital expenditure than basic hydraulic alternatives but yield superior operational longevity and lower lifecycle power consumption.
  • Structural Demands and Site Age: New construction designs easily integrate standard concrete elevator shafts. Retrofitting premium elevators into established multi-decade old villas requires structural steel frame stabilization or internal concrete slab core-cutting, adding significant structural overheads.
  • Equipment Brand and Origin: Global tier-one manufacturers like Schindler maintain strict global engineering protocols, utilize high-grade metallurgy, and feature robust cybersecurity controls in their control systems. This premium Swiss-engineered background justifies the cost premium over unbranded local assembling operations.

1. Engineering Consultation and Feasibility Studies

We initiate the technical process by analyzing architectural drawings to calculate traffic patterns, clear overhead spaces, and pit depth boundaries. This phase establishes the definitive component configurations required for the property.

2. Technical Site Audit and Shaft Metric Validation

Field engineers conduct laser-guided verticality checks on the raw civil shaft shell. We verify that the shaft walls maintain strict plumb tolerances, and ensure that the pit floor has appropriate waterproofing treatments to withstand regional groundwater pressure.

3. Component Manufacturing and Logistics Management

Upon verifying the civil shaft metrics, the engineering specifications are finalized for production. The specialized gearless traction machines, customized cabin interiors, and precision microprocessors are assembled and transported directly to the site under strict environmental controls.

4. Structural Mechanical Assembly and Integration

Field installation technicians assemble the structural car frames, mount the primary T-guide rails, and suspend the low-friction traction media. This critical phase requires high precision to eliminate any micro-vibrations that could degrade long-term ride quality.

5. Electronic Tuning and Statutory Commissioning

Software engineers configure the variable frequency drive curves, program the electronic deceleration zones, and test the full suite of safety mechanisms. The system undergoes rigid structural weight-loading trials before being submitted for final state safety certification.

Documentation and Compliance Framework

Residential elevator projects in Telangana must comply with rigorous statutory requirements. Private villa elevators are subject to strict public safety codes, governed by national engineering standards and regional legislation.

Property developers must align their installation programs with the following regulatory frameworks:

  • Bureau of Indian Standards (BIS): All structural equipment and installation procedures must conform strictly to the IS 17967 code series, which governs specialized residential lift design, safety systems, and operational speed thresholds.
  • National Building Code (NBC): The NBC 2016 (Part 8, Section 5) defines the mandatory architectural provisions for vertical transit. This includes precise guidelines for ventilation, clear overhead space minimums, and emergency egress routing.
  • The Telangana Lifts, Escalators and Passenger Conveyors Act: It is illegal to operate a vertical lift system in Hyderabad without formal registration. Property owners must file structural line layouts with the Chief Electrical Inspectorate to the Government (CEIG) to secure an initial “Permission to Erect,” followed by a final annual “Licence to Operate.”

Warranty Paradigms and Asset Maintenance Options

A luxury elevator installation represents a multi-decade asset that requires consistent technical oversight. Standard original equipment manufacturing agreements typically include a comprehensive 12-month structural warranty covering factory defects and foundational component misalignments. Following this initial period, asset owners must transition to an Annual Maintenance Contract (AMC) to preserve operational safety and protect the equipment’s valuation.

Property managers can choose between two clear operational maintenance frameworks:

Comprehensive Annual Maintenance Contracts

This premium operational format covers all routine monthly lubrication procedures, minor tuning adjustments, and emergency breakdown attendance. It also fully covers the financial cost of replacing expensive capital components, such as main traction motors, controller circuit cards, passenger door sensors, and backup battery banks.

Non-Comprehensive Annual Maintenance Contracts

This lower-cost entry option covers standard preventative maintenance labor and basic system testing. However, the building owner assumes full direct liability for the cost of any replacement parts or heavy component repair requirements discovered during service cycles.

Why Professional Engineering Providers Matter

What are the main technical risks of using uncertified elevator technicians?

Using uncertified technicians leads to common issues like chronic shaft rail misalignment, premature wear on suspension media, unstable braking profiles, and unexpected system shutdowns. More importantly, non-compliant installations lack validated emergency backup integration, which creates serious passenger safety risks during building power drops.

Professional engineering firms follow strict, multi-point safety check protocols before handing over any residential asset. These specialists carefully calibrate the interaction between governor-tripped safety blocks and structural guide rails to ensure emergency stopping mechanisms deploy instantly if cabin velocities exceed safe limits.

Furthermore, certified installation teams ensure full compliance with the strict structural grounding and surge protection standards required by modern microprocessor panels. Safeguarding this electrical infrastructure protects sensitive solid-state components from the erratic voltage fluctuations common to municipal grids, extending the service life of your investment.

Frequently Asked Questions

1. What is the starting Schindler home lift price in India?

The baseline Schindler home lift price in India begins at approximately INR 12,00,000 for standard machine-room-less configurations serving up to three floors. Premium aesthetics, additional stops, and structural modifications will scale the cost upward.

2. Does the civil shaft construction cost include itself in the elevator quote?

No, standard elevator quotes do not cover the civil construction of the concrete shaft, structural masonry, or core cutting. The property owner must execute these works separately through local civil contractors according to the engineering layouts provided by the elevator engineering team.

3. Which regularisation rules govern villa elevator installations in Hyderabad?

Villa elevator installations fall under the statutory jurisdiction of the Telangana Lifts, Escalators and Passenger Conveyors Act. Property owners must secure an initial permission to erect, followed by a formal licence to operate issued by the Chief Electrical Inspectorate.

4. How much vertical space does a typical machine-room-less elevator require at the top?

A standard machine-room-less residential elevator requires a clear overhead height of 3800 mm to 4000 mm measured from the final finished floor level of the topmost landing to the underside of the shaft ceiling slab.

5. What is the standard electrical power requirement for modern residential elevators?

Modern premium residential traction elevators generally run on a three-phase 415V, 50Hz power supply to maintain optimum ride stability and torque control. However, selected low-rise configurations are engineered to operate on a single-phase 230V domestic supply.

6. What is the clear difference between comprehensive and non-comprehensive elevator AMC plans?

A comprehensive AMC encompasses routine lubrication, service visits, emergency breakdowns, and the entire cost of replacing expensive capital components like inverter drives and controller boards. A non-comprehensive AMC charges the asset owner separately for any spare parts used.

7. How often should a residential elevator undergo routine safety inspections?

According to Indian Standard guidelines and state safety norms, a residential elevator must undergo professional preventative maintenance checks once every single month to examine safety gear, brakes, and door interlocks.

8. Can we retrofit an premium traction lift in an existing villa that lacks a built-in shaft?

Yes, we frequently retrofit premium traction lifts in established properties by erecting an external self-supporting structural steel glass frame or by cutting out slab sections within a central stairwell cavity.
